
About Company
Gemini Trust Company, LLC (Gemini) is a next generation cryptocurrency exchange and custodian that allows customers to buy, sell, stake, and store digital assets such as bitcoin and ether. Gemini is a New York trust company that is held to the highest level of fiduciary obligations, capital reserve requirements, and banking compliance standards. Gemini was founded in 2014, by brothers Cameron and Tyler Winklevoss, to build a bridge to the future of money. For more information, visit Gemini.com.
